Palayamkottai: Recently, a case of crime has come out of Tamil Nadu. There has been triple murder and now a shocking revelation has been made in the case. Two transgenders and a male were killed and the dead bodies were thrown into the well. It is being told that they were killed by strangulation. According to the news, three people have been arrested by the police in this case and now all three are being questioned.

This incident is being reported from Palayamkottai in Tirunelveli, Tamil Nadu. In this case, the police said that 'the bodies were packed in bags and thrown away. The dead have been identified as Anushka (35), Bhavani (34) and Murugan (38). In this case, the police said, 'Murugan married Anushka and Bhavani. He wanted to adopt a child. He gave five lakh rupees to a person named Hrishikesh for this. After receiving the money, Hrishikesh started avoiding him. Allegedly he cheated on them".

Apart from this, the police said that Murugan started messaging on social media to Hrishikesh's sister. After that Hrishikesh got angry when he came to know about this. He then murdered Murugan, Anushka and Bhavani together with his two companions. Later, the trio packed their dead bodies in bags and threw them in a well near the highway. In this case, some transgender complained to the police that they were unable to contact Anushka and Bhavani. After that, the police started the investigation and then the murder case was revealed.
